Vision and mission
Advancing entrepreneurship and entrepreneurs through knowledge
Sten K. Johnson Centre for Entrepreneurship aims to be one of the leading centres in Europe with regard to knowledge development and dissemination aiming to strengthen entrepreneurship and entrepreneurs.

The vision will be realised by three interconnected fields of activities:
Education
The Centre provides entrepreneurial education of high international standard, targeting national and international stakeholders, including students from all faculties and levels of study, as well as external partners. The action-oriented approach to teaching conveys knowledge based on contemporary research within the field.
Research
The Centre conducts cutting-edge research on entrepreneurial phenomena across various contexts. Research areas involve entrepreneurial education and learning, refugee entrepreneurship, community currencies, innovation theatre in the entrepreneurship industry, and entrepreneurial ownership and finance.
Strategic networks
The Centre initiates and develops strategic relations for mutual knowledge exchange with national and international universities, alumni, partners from the industry and other stakeholders with interest in entrepreneurship.
